Raspberry Jalepeno Jam

Anyway, here is the recipe:
5 cups of fresh raspberries, washed
1/2 green bell pepper, washed, seeded, and chopped
3 jalapeno peppers, washed, seeded, and chopped
5 cups sugar
1/2 cup cider vinegar
1 box pectin
yields: 7 half pints
If you want more spice, then don't seed one or all of the jalapenos.
Measure out raspberries in a bowl. Mush them so they get quite juicy but there are still chunks of raspberries remaining. Use your hands.
We used gloves so the berries didn't stain our hands. I did not buy fresh raspberries. You can find frozen raspberries in the freezer section of the store. Make sure they do not have syrup in them though. Walmart has a great value brand that has 2.5 cups in each one, so it worked perfect to buy 2 bags per batch. We also put the peppers in the blender with the cider vinegar to chop them up.
Add the chopped bell pepper, jalapenos, and vinegar to the berries and mix.

In a separate bowl, mix 1 box of pectin with 1/4 cup of the sugar. Measure out remaining sugar into another bowl.
Place berry-pepper mixture in a pot and bring to a full boil over high heat, stirring so the mixture does not burn. Once at a boil, stir in the pectin-sugar mixture and bring back to a boil. Add the remaining sugar to the pot and stir. Bring to a vigorous boil again, while stirring continuously. Boil hard, continuing to stir for 1 minute (1 minute only).
Remove from heat, skim off the scum, stir and ladle hot jam into sterilized jars, securing lids tightly. Process in water bath canner for 10 minutes, adjusting for altitude (I have to do 20) Once done, remove jars and allow to cool.
